Developing reproducible strategies for managing and distributing synthetic datasets that mimic production characteristics without exposing secrets.
This article outlines durable methods for creating and sharing synthetic data that faithfully reflect production environments while preserving confidentiality, governance, and reproducibility across teams and stages of development.
August 08, 2025
Facebook X Reddit
In modern data workflows the demand for synthetic datasets grows as teams balance openness with safety. Reproducibility matters because it enables engineers, researchers, and analysts to validate experiments, compare approaches, and scale experiments across environments. The challenge is producing data that captures the legitimate statistical properties of production without leaking confidential signals. Effective strategies begin with a clear definition of the target characteristics: distributions, correlations, and edge cases that influence model performance. A well-documented seed strategy, version-controlled data generation scripts, and deterministic pipelines help ensure that every run yields expected results. By aligning data generation with governance policies, organizations lay a foundation for reliable experimentation.
An essential aspect is separating synthetic data design from the production data it imitates. This separation reduces risk by modeling only synthetic parameters, not real identifiers or sensitive attributes. Designers should specify acceptable ranges, noise levels, and transformation rules that preserve utility for testing and development while preventing inversions or reidentification. Combining synthetic data with controlled masking techniques creates a layered defense that keeps secrets safe. Reproducibility thrives when teams adopt modular components: seedable random samplers, parameter catalogs, and artifact repositories that store configurations alongside the data. Such modularity supports rapid iteration, auditability, and clearer accountability for data provenance.
Reproducibility hinges on modular design, versioning, and safety-first generation.
The governance layer is the cognitive map that keeps synthetic data aligned with compliance requirements and business objectives. Clear policies describe who may generate, access, and modify synthetic datasets, along with the conditions for distribution to external partners. Auditable logs document every step: data generation parameters, seed values, version numbers, and validation results. With reproducibility at the core, teams implement automated checks that compare produced data against predefined metrics, ensuring the synthetic mirror remains within acceptable tolerances. When governance and reproducibility converge, teams gain confidence that synthetic environments reflect reality without exposing sensitive attributes or secrets.
ADVERTISEMENT
ADVERTISEMENT
Validation is the practical hinge between theory and production readiness. It relies on quantitative benchmarks that measure similarity to target distributions, correlation structures, and downstream model impact. Comprehensive test suites verify that synthetic data preserves key signals while omitting confidential identifiers. Tests also examine edge cases, rare events, and shift conditions to assure resilience across tasks. Documentation accompanies every test, stating expected ranges, known limitations, and remediation steps. By codifying validation as a repeatable process, organizations build trust in synthetic environments and reduce the friction of adoption across data science, engineering, and analytics teams.
Documentation and transparency support consistent replication across teams.
A modular design approach treats data generation as a composition of interchangeable blocks. Each block encapsulates a specific transformation, such as generative sampling, feature scaling, or attribute masking, making it easier to swap components while preserving overall behavior. Versioning these components, along with the generated datasets, creates a transparent history that stakeholders can review. When a change is made—whether to the seed, the distribution, or the masking logic—the system records an immutable lineage. This lineage supports rollback, comparison, and auditability, which are essential for meeting governance and regulatory expectations in production-like settings.
ADVERTISEMENT
ADVERTISEMENT
Safety-first generation is not an afterthought; it is integral to the design. Safeguards include restricting access to sensitive seeds, encrypting configuration files, and employing role-based permissions. Data generation pipelines should also incorporate anomaly detectors that flag unusual outputs or suspicious patterns that could indicate leakage. A strong practice is to separate synthetic data environments from production networks, using synthetic keys and isolated runtimes where possible. By embedding security into the fabric of the workflow, teams minimize the risk of secrets exposure while maintaining the ability to reproduce results across teams, tools, and platforms.
Scalable distribution balances access, privacy, and speed.
Documentation of synthetic data processes should cover the rationale behind choices, the expected behavior of each component, and the exact steps to reproduce results. Clear READMEs, parameter catalogs, and runbooks guide new contributors and veteran practitioners alike. The goal is to reduce ambiguity so that a teammate in another department can generate the same synthetic dataset and achieve comparable outcomes. Rich descriptions of distributions, dependencies, and constraints aid cross-functional collaboration and training. Transparent documentation also helps third-party auditors verify that safeguards against disclosure are active and effective over time.
Beyond internal documentation, shared standards and templates foster consistency. Organizations benefit from establishing a library of vetted templates for seed usage, data generation scripts, and validation metrics. Standardized templates accelerate onboarding, improve interoperability across platforms, and simplify external collaboration under compliance mandates. When teams align on a common vocabulary and structure for synthetic data projects, they reduce misinterpretations and errors. Consistency in practice leads to more reliable results, easier benchmarking, and a stronger culture of responsible experimentation.
ADVERTISEMENT
ADVERTISEMENT
Practical strategies unify ethics, efficiency, and effectiveness.
Distribution of synthetic datasets requires careful planning to avoid bottlenecks while preserving privacy guarantees. One practical approach is to host synthetic assets in controlled repositories with access governance that enforces least privilege. Automated provisioning enables authorized users to retrieve data quickly without exposing raw secrets, while data fingerprints and integrity checks confirm that datasets have not been tampered with in transit. Additionally, embedding usage policies within data catalogs clarifies permissible analyses and downstream sharing constraints. As teams scale, automation reduces manual intervention, enabling consistent, repeatable distributions that still meet security and compliance requirements.
Performance considerations matter as synthetic datasets grow in size and complexity. Efficient data pipelines leverage streaming or batched generation with parallel processing to maintain reasonable turnaround times. Resource-aware scheduling prevents contention in shared environments, ensuring that experiments remain reproducible even under heavy load. Caching intermediate results and reusing validated components minimize redundant computation and support faster iterations. Monitoring dashboards track generation times, error rates, and distribution fidelity, providing real-time visibility that helps engineers respond promptly to deviations and maintain reproducibility in dynamic, multi-team ecosystems.
Ethical considerations guide every phase of synthetic data work, from design to distribution. Respect for privacy implies that synthetic attributes should be generated without revealing real individuals or sensitive traits, even accidentally. Transparent disclosure about limitations and potential biases helps stakeholders interpret results responsibly. Efficiency comes from automating repetitive steps and prebuilding validated components that can be reused across projects. Effectiveness emerges when teams align on measurable outcomes, such as how well synthetic data supports model testing, integration checks, and governance audits. A balanced approach yields dependable experimentation while preserving trust and safety.
Finally, the long horizon depends on continual improvement. Teams should periodically refresh synthetic datasets to reflect evolving production patterns and emerging threats. Lessons learned from each cycle inform updates to seeds, distributions, and validation criteria. Regular retrospectives about reproducibility practices help sustain momentum and prevent drift. By institutionalizing feedback loops, organizations ensure that synthetic data remains a powerful, responsible instrument for development, research, and collaboration without compromising secrets or safety.
Related Articles
In operational analytics, constructing holdout sets requires thoughtful sampling that balances common patterns with rare, edge-case events, ensuring evaluation mirrors real-world variability and stress conditions.
This evergreen guide outlines practical, replicable methods for assessing hyperparameter importance, enabling data scientists to allocate tuning effort toward parameters with the greatest impact on model performance, reliability, and efficiency.
August 04, 2025
This article explains practical strategies for aggregating evaluation metrics across diverse test environments, detailing methods that preserve fairness, reduce bias, and support transparent model comparison in real-world heterogeneity.
August 12, 2025
Crafting robust evaluation methods requires aligning metrics with genuine user value, ensuring consistency, transparency, and adaptability across contexts to avoid misleading proxy-driven conclusions.
The rise of lightweight causal discovery tools promises practical guidance for feature engineering, enabling teams to streamline models while maintaining resilience and generalization across diverse, real-world data environments.
This evergreen guide outlines repeatable strategies, practical frameworks, and verifiable experiments to assess resilience of ML systems when integrated with external APIs and third-party components across evolving pipelines.
A practical guide to orchestrating expansive hyperparameter sweeps with spot instances, balancing price volatility, reliability, scheduling, and automation to maximize model performance while controlling total expenditure.
August 08, 2025
In an era of pervasive personalization, rigorous, repeatable validation processes are essential to detect, quantify, and mitigate echo chamber effects, safeguarding fair access to diverse information and enabling accountable algorithmic behavior.
August 05, 2025
This evergreen guide explains a practical approach to building cross-team governance for experiments, detailing principles, structures, and processes that align compute budgets, scheduling, and resource allocation across diverse teams and platforms.
Systematic perturbation analysis provides a practical framework for unveiling how slight, plausible input changes influence model outputs, guiding stability assessments, robust design, and informed decision-making in real-world deployments while ensuring safer, more reliable AI systems.
August 04, 2025
This evergreen guide explores how practitioners can rigorously audit feature influence on model outputs by combining counterfactual reasoning with perturbation strategies, ensuring reproducibility, transparency, and actionable insights across domains.
A practical guide to designing anomaly scores that effectively flag model performance deviations while balancing automation with essential human review for timely, responsible interventions.
This evergreen guide explains how to build reproducible dashboards for experimental analysis, focusing on confounders and additional controls to strengthen causal interpretations while maintaining clarity and auditability for teams.
A practical guide to building ongoing validation pipelines that fuse upstream model checks with real-world usage signals, ensuring robust performance, fairness, and reliability across evolving environments.
Small teams can optimize hyperparameters without overspending by embracing iterative, scalable strategies, cost-aware experimentation, and pragmatic tooling, ensuring durable performance gains while respecting budget constraints and organizational capabilities.
This evergreen exploration explains how automated failure case mining uncovers hard examples, shapes retraining priorities, and sustains model performance over time through systematic, data-driven improvement cycles.
August 08, 2025
This evergreen guide explains step by step how to design reproducible workflows that generate adversarial test suites aligned with distinct model architectures and task requirements, ensuring reliable evaluation, auditability, and continual improvement.
This guide outlines practical, reproducible strategies for engineering learning rate schedules and warm restarts to stabilize training, accelerate convergence, and enhance model generalization across varied architectures and datasets.
This comprehensive guide unveils how to design orchestration frameworks that flexibly allocate heterogeneous compute, minimize idle time, and promote reproducible experiments across diverse hardware environments with persistent visibility.
August 08, 2025
Designing scalable metadata schemas for experiment results opens pathways to efficient querying, cross-project comparability, and deeper meta-analysis, transforming how experiments inform strategy, learning, and continuous improvement across teams and environments.
August 08, 2025